In the whimsical world crafted by Bill Watterson, readers are invited to immerse themselves in the imaginative adventures of a young boy named Calvin and his sardonic stuffed tiger, Hobbes. Set against the backdrop of childhood curiosity and mischief, this collection of comics showcases the duo navigating the trials and tribulations of growing up. Their escapades range from the innocent to the profound, interspersed with humor that resonates across generations.
Calvin’s boundless imagination turns everyday moments into extraordinary adventures. Whether he's transforming his bedroom into a spaceship or pondering the complexities of life with Hobbes by his side, each strip captures the essence of childhood wonder and the deep bond of friendship. The contrast between Calvin’s wild antics and Hobbes’ grounded wisdom adds depth to their interactions, inviting readers to reflect on the nature of reality and imagination.
As they tackle themes of family dynamics and the antics of Calvin’s often exasperated father, the narratives provide a lighthearted yet insightful commentary on parenting. This treasury not only highlights the creativity of childhood but also serves as a reminder of the value of friendship, imagination, and the humorous chaos of growing up.
